Asian Phytoceuticals Public Company Limited  (“The Company” or “APCO”) was founded on 2 June 1988 under the name Natural Cosmetic Research Co., Ltd. to operate the business of manufacturing and distributing beauty & cosmetic products and dietary supplements developed from natural plant and botanical extracts. In 2005 the Company registered its conversion to a public company limited and at the same time changed its name to Asian Phytoceuticals Public Company Limited.  On 4 November 2011 the Company was listed on the Market for Alternative Investment (MAI) under the stock symbol “APCO”.  On 14 May 2018 it was moved to be traded as listed securities on the Stock Exchange of Thailand (SET).
